      Charles (Bill) Skinner, 89 of Coldbrook and formerly South Berwick, NS passed away on May 11, 2016 in the Valley Regional Hospital. He was the son of the late Margaret and Theo Skinner.
       Bill worked for many years as a heavy equipment operator, farmer, and snow plow driver followed by fifteen years at Weavexx. His retirement years were filled with many interests including his woodlot, gardening, fixing and restoring old engines and chainsaws. Most recently his passion was supporting and contributing to the history of farming through the Northville Farm Heritage Centre. He was also a member of the Nova Scotia Antique Engine & Tractor Association. He and son Tom were named Woodlot Owners of the Year for 2000. His love of dogs, particularly German Shepherds, was evident, with one at his side or riding with him on a tractor or backhoe on the farm in South Berwick.
       He is survived by his wife of sixty years Doris (Chute), daughters Anna (Jack) Schofield of Coldbrook, Mary (Wendy Russell) of Lower Sackville, son Tom (Susan) Skinner of Millville, four grandchildren, Kim (John) Hill, Shannon (Chris) MacInnis, Matthew (Sarah) Skinner, Christa (Steph Irving) Skinner, seven great-grandchildren, Julie and Madalyn Hill, Nathan, Avery, and Charlee MacInnis, and John and Ava Skinner, and brother Richard (Jo-Ann) Skinner of Cambridge.
       Bill was predeceased by not only his parents but a brother John as well as a sister-in-law Veronica.
